12 Channel Electrocardiograph Market Size, A Comprehensive Outlook and Forecast for 2026-2035

The global 12 channel electrocardiograph market was valued at approximately USD 1.8 billion in 2025 and is expected to reach nearly USD 3.9 billion by 2035. The market is anticipated to expand at a CAGR of 9.6% during the forecast period from 2026 to 2035. The sustained growth trajectory is primarily attributed to the increasing prevalence of cardiovascular disorders, rising healthcare digitization, growing adoption of portable cardiac monitoring systems, and advancements in wireless ECG technologies. In addition, the growing emphasis on preventive healthcare and remote patient monitoring is significantly supporting market expansion across developed and emerging economies.
The increasing burden of lifestyle-associated cardiac diseases, combined with expanding geriatric populations worldwide, has elevated the need for accurate and rapid cardiac diagnostic systems. Furthermore, the integration of artificial intelligence, cloud-based data analytics, and telemedicine platforms into electrocardiograph systems is accelerating product adoption among hospitals, ambulatory surgical centers, specialty cardiac clinics, and home healthcare settings.

12 Channel Electrocardiograph Industry Demand
A 12 channel electrocardiograph is an advanced diagnostic medical device designed to record the electrical activity of the heart from twelve different perspectives simultaneously. These devices are extensively used for diagnosing arrhythmias, myocardial infarction, ischemic heart disease, conduction abnormalities, and other cardiovascular conditions. The system generates highly detailed cardiac waveforms that help physicians evaluate heart rhythm irregularities and structural cardiac abnormalities with improved precision.
Modern 12 channel electrocardiographs are increasingly equipped with digital displays, wireless connectivity, automated interpretation software, cloud integration, touch-screen interfaces, and AI-powered analytics. These innovations are improving workflow efficiency, diagnostic accuracy, and patient management capabilities across healthcare facilities.

Holter Monitors
Holter monitors represent a critical segment for long-term ambulatory cardiac monitoring. These devices are widely used to identify intermittent arrhythmias and abnormal cardiac events that may not appear during routine ECG examinations. Rising awareness regarding continuous cardiac monitoring and increasing outpatient care services are contributing to segment expansion.

Holter Monitoring
Holter monitoring applications are expanding due to increasing demand for continuous ambulatory cardiac assessment. Physicians frequently utilize these systems for evaluating irregular heart rhythms, palpitations, and unexplained syncope episodes. Technological advancements in wearable monitoring devices are strengthening segment development.
Stress Testing
Stress testing applications are witnessing increasing utilization in sports medicine, cardiology clinics, and preventive healthcare programs. ECG-based stress testing assists physicians in evaluating cardiac performance under physical exertion and identifying exercise-induced abnormalities.
